ajax https 请求数据;ajax请求数据的https中心

Ajax通过HTTPS请求数据的中心,共分为六个方面进行讨论。Ajax是一种在不刷新整个页面的情况下,通过与服务器进行异步通信来更新部分网页的技术。而HTTPS则是一种通过加密保护数据传输的协议。结合两者,可以实现安全的数据传输和动态网页更新。

方面一:Ajax的基本原理

Ajax全称Asynchronous JavaScript And XML,是一种基于JavaScript和XML的技术。它通过XMLHttpRequest对象向服务器发送请求,并通过回调函数处理服务器返回的数据。这种异步通信的方式使得网页能够实现动态更新,提升用户体验。

方面二:HTTPS的基本原理

HTTPS是HTTP协议的安全版本,通过使用SSL/TLS协议对数据进行加密传输,保证了数据的安全性和完整性。HTTPS使用了公钥加密和私钥解密的方式来实现数据的加密和解密,同时还能验证服务器的身份,防止中间人攻击。

方面三:Ajax请求数据的流程

当使用Ajax进行数据请求时,需要创建XMLHttpRequest对象,并指定请求的URL和请求方法。然后通过open()方法和send()方法发送请求,并通过onreadystatechange事件监听服务器返回的数据。当服务器返回数据时,可以通过status属性判断请求的结果,并通过responseText或responseXML获取服务器返回的数据。

方面四:使用HTTPS进行数据传输的优势

HTTPS通过加密传输数据,可以有效防止数据被窃取或篡改。HTTPS还能验证服务器的身份,确保数据的发送和接收方是可信的。这样可以保护用户的隐私和数据安全,提升用户对网站的信任度。

方面五:Ajax请求数据的安全性

在使用Ajax请求数据时,由于数据是通过HTTPS进行传输的,所以数据在传输过程中是被加密的,不容易被窃取。由于HTTPS能验证服务器的身份,可以防止中间人攻击,确保数据的发送和接收方是可信的。仍需注意在前端代码中进行参数校验和输入过滤,以防止XSS攻击和SQL注入等安全问题。

方面六:Ajax请求数据的应用场景

Ajax通过与服务器的异步通信,可以实现动态更新网页的功能。这种特性使得Ajax广泛应用于各种场景,如实时搜索、表单验证、无刷新评论等。而通过使用HTTPS进行数据传输,可以保证数据的安全性,适用于涉及用户隐私和敏感数据的场景。

Ajax通过与服务器的异步通信,实现了网页的动态更新。而通过使用HTTPS进行数据传输,保证了数据的安全性和完整性。结合两者,可以实现安全的数据传输和动态网页更新。在实际应用中,需要注意数据的安全性和前端代码的安全性,以保护用户的隐私和数据安全。Ajax与HTTPS的结合也为各种实时性要求高、安全性要求高的应用场景提供了解决方案。

Image

文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/111634.html<

(0)
运维的头像运维
上一篇2025-02-17 02:24
下一篇 2025-02-17 02:26

相关推荐

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注